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ine
Curriculum
The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ine (D.O.) is a professional degree which requires four years of professional study. Our innovative curriculum is designed to fulfill our mission of training primary care physicians. Its design is based on successful academic models, carefully developed and integrated.
The unique curriculum provides academic and clinical training which prepares students for the "real world" of medicine. It will make you more competitive for postdoctoral training positions and more attractive to those interviewing candidates for those positions.
A notable aspect of our clinical training program is a three-month clinical rotation at a rural setting where many residents have little access to health care. You will learn to treat various cultural and ethnic groups whose lifestyles and attitudes toward health care differ from those you will see in more traditional training sites. It is an enriching educational experience.
Advanced Placement Opportunities
NSU-COM offers advanced placement to incoming students with graduate degrees or undergraduate majors in disciplines that are specifically related to courses or subject areas that are required for graduation. To receive advanced placement (AP) for any course, the student will be required to pass the NBME Discipline Based Shelf Examination to determine their competency in the subject matter involved. Students who are successful in this effort will receive advanced placement by being given credit equivalent to the course(s) involved on their transcripts. The time made available by being deferred from enrolling in these course(s), will provide time for these students to serve as a teaching assistant/tutors.
